Travelling through the Swan Valley we arrive at New Norcia, home to Australia’s only monastic town which is renowned for its Benedictine Abbey. A little piece of Spain comes alive in this town, full of History, art, and architecture. Hear the local history before viewing the chapel and museum artefacts gifted to the monastery by Popes and Royalty of Spain.
Visit the Famous Benedictine Community with a guided tour of the town and main sites including the museum and art gallery where you will find extraordinary artefacts dating back to when New Norcia was an Aboriginal mission. Next we move on to the Abbey Church; home to one of only two large Moser organs, originally crafted in Germany, followed by a visit to St Gertrude’s College, a grand gothic style building which was originally built as a girl’s boarding school and opened in 1908.
We then visit a produce shop selling olive oil, fruit, wine, New Norcia nut cake and breads before enjoying a delicious lunch. Following lunch we head off for an easy paced walk through the mystical Pinnacles Desert and see the Pinnacles from the look out over the park and if time permits make a visit to the Pinnacles Desert Discovery Centre.
Return to Perth down the Indian Ocean Drive stopping to view Wildflowers en route (seasonal), arriving at approximately 7.30pm.
